Transaction 0ef8c167615870577b292d3b99bea34e11c64a37e0ed6df5fe9bc9f99c792605
1 Input
1 Output
-
0ef8c167615870577b292d3b99bea34e11c64a37e0ed6df5fe9bc9f99c792605:0
- value
- 579054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3796574c0d0ae826d9f07d113efacac0a123c11b OP_EQUAL
- address
- 36kwByF76oB1oJcJqYeVRauT7iEiu2QWwo